In this program based in Santiago de los Caballeros, Dominican Republic, you will advance your Spanish-language skills in an immersive environment where you interact meaningfully with local people and cultural events. 

Students will live with host families, participate in daily language classes in Santiago, explore historical sites, and engage in a variety of cultural activities. Excursions will include visits to the Cabarete region, Cayo Arena, and the Los Pepines murals.

As you develop your Spanish proficiency, you will uncover narratives of resistance, sustainability, and Dominican culture, applying your understanding of global systems to a local context.

In partnership with the Council on International Education Exchange.
